5.6 Cleaning

If instrument is unmounted at time of cleaning, disconnect the

instrument from the power source. Close and latch the front-panel access
door. Clean outside surfaces with a soft cloth dampened slightly with plain
clean water. Do not use any harsh solvents such as paint thinner or benzene.

For panel-mounted instruments, clean the front panel as prescribed

in the above paragraph. DO NOT wipe front panel while the instrument
is controlling your process.

5.7 Troubleshooting

Table 5-2: Troubleshooting

Problem Possible

Cause Solution

Erratic readings of the
oxygen concentration
as reported by the
analyzer

Analyzer may have
been calibrated in an
inaccurate fashion.

Recalibrate analyzer,
making sure the
proper gas is fed, and
the proper value of
span gas is input.

Atmospheric oxygen
diffusing through vent
and altering the
oxygen level the
sensor sees

Increase flow rate
and/or length of vent
tubing to dilute or
minimize oxygen
diffusion from vent to
sensor.

Inaccurate zero
operation

Zero calibration using a
gas with a
concentration different
from air.

Rezero the instrument
using air.
